    What Is Nitro Coffee?

    Nitro coffee is a cold brew coffee infused with nitrogen gas, creating a rich, creamy texture and a frothy layer on top. This process results in a beverage that’s more satisfying than regular coffee. The nitrogen gives it a smooth finish, almost like a stout beer. You won’t need cream or sugar; the flavor remains robust and delicious on its own.

    Nitro coffee is typically served on draft, much like beer, from a tap. This unique serving method contributes to its velvety texture. When you pour it, you notice a cascade effect, similar to how a Guinness settles. This visual appeal enhances your coffee-drinking experience.

    Many enjoy nitro coffee not just for its taste but also for its caffeine content. While cold brew coffee usually has a higher caffeine level than regular brewed coffee, nitro coffee tends to maintain those properties without compromising flavor. It’s an excellent option for a midday energy boost.

    Ingredients Needed

    To create nitro coffee at home, gather the following essential ingredients and equipment.

    Coffee Selection

    • Coffee Beans: Choose high-quality, coarsely ground coffee beans for optimal flavor extraction. A medium to dark roast works well, as it provides robust flavors. Aim for approximately 1 cup of coffee to create 4 cups of cold brew.
    • Water: Use filtered water to maintain a clean taste. You’ll need about 4 cups of water for brewing your coffee.
    • Nitro Coffee Maker: A specialized nitro coffee maker or a whipped cream dispenser with a nitrogen charger enhances the coffee’s texture. Ensure it’s compatible with nitrogen canisters.
    • Cold Brew Coffee Maker: If you don’t have a nitro maker, a standard cold brew maker or a large jar also works for brewing.
    • Nitrogen Canisters: Stock up on food-grade nitrogen cartridges to infuse the cold brew with nitrogen.
    • Fine Mesh Strainer: This helps filter out coffee grounds from your cold brew.
    • Storage Container: A clean, airtight container is essential for storing your cold brew before nitro infusion.

    By gathering these ingredients and equipment, you’re all set to brew your own smooth and creamy nitro coffee at home.

    Step-By-Step Guide On How To Make Nitro Coffee

    Making nitro coffee at home is straightforward. Follow these easy steps to enjoy your smooth, creamy brew.

    Brewing The Coffee

    1. Choose Your Coffee: Select high-quality, coarsely ground coffee beans. Aim for a medium to dark roast for the best flavor.
    2. Measure Coffee and Water: Use a coffee-to-water ratio of 1:4. For example, use 1 cup (approximately 85 grams) of coffee with 4 cups (1 liter) of filtered water.
    3. Brew the Coffee: Combine ground coffee and water in a cold brew coffee maker. Let it steep for 12 to 24 hours in the refrigerator. The longer you steep, the stronger the flavor.
    4. Strain the Coffee: After steeping, strain the coffee using a fine mesh strainer or coffee filter. Ensure all grounds are removed for a smooth finish.
    1. Prepare Nitro Coffee Maker: If you have a nitro coffee maker, fill it with the brewed cold coffee. If using a whipped cream dispenser, pour the coffee into the dispenser.
    2. Add Nitrogen: Attach the nitrogen canister. For the nitro coffee maker, follow the manufacturer’s instructions. If using a whipped cream dispenser, charge it with one nitrogen canister.
    3. Shake It Up: Shake the dispenser vigorously for about 30 seconds. This action helps the nitrogen mix properly with the coffee, creating that iconic creamy texture.
    4. Serve Immediately: Pour the nitro coffee into a glass. Watch the mesmerizing cascade effect as the bubbles rise. Enjoy it straight for a pure taste, or you can add flavored syrups if desired.

    This process yields delicious nitro coffee ready to be savored any time of day.

    Serving Suggestions

    Nitro coffee offers a delightful experience that you can enhance with thoughtful serving options. Consider these ideas to elevate your nitro coffee enjoyment.

    Best Pairings

    • Breakfast Foods: Nitro coffee pairs well with items like pancakes, waffles, or oatmeal. The smooth texture complements sweet flavors well.
    • Savory Snacks: Enjoy nitro coffee with savory options like avocado toast, breakfast burritos, or cheese pastries. The rich coffee balances salty flavors.
    • Desserts: Treat yourself by pairing nitro coffee with chocolate cake, brownies, or a scoop of vanilla ice cream. The contrast between the coffee’s bitterness and the sweetness of desserts creates a pleasing taste experience.
    • Glassware: Serve your nitro coffee in clear glass cups or mugs. This allows you and your guests to enjoy the coffee’s beautiful cascade effect.
    • Garnishes: Add a dash of cinnamon or cocoa powder on top for a hint of flavor and an appealing visual touch.
    • Ice Cubes: Use coffee ice cubes made from leftover nitro coffee. These keep your drink chilled without diluting it.
    • Flavored Syrups: Consider offering flavored syrups, such as vanilla or caramel, on the side for those who might want a sweeter drink.
